Job Description

Since 2016, growing number of Korean experts and volunteers have been play their roles in Egypt. In order to provide more proper service for the safety and security of our staff and Korean workers in the field, KOICA Egypt office is preparing to improve the protocol for safety and security management.

This job is for Egyptian nationals only.

Contract Period

1 year with 3-month probationary period

(Contract period can be extended according to the performance evaluation)

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ary focal point for safety and security for the Office;
  • Develop and update safety and security management plan for the Office;
  • Provide technical support to the staff and personnel in the field in the following areas:
  • Security/risk assessment
  • Security plan development, scenario planning
  • Crisis/contingency plan

Other security-related functions;

  • Provide advice and counsel to management on matters relating to employee and property safety and security;
  • Develop and facilitate security and safety training for the Office;
  • Perform field surveys on the site where KOICA volunteers are to be dispatched;
  • Monitor security conditions and liaise and coordinate with external agencies – UN, local government, etc.

Job Requirements

Education:

  • Bachelor’s degree (preferable if in International Relations, Criminal Justice, Homeland Security, Security Administration or related area or ability to demonstrate a work-based equivalent)

Experience:

  • Minimum 5 years implementing security programs and a strong knowledge of security management in complex environments;
  • Preferable when an applicant
  • Has some familiarity with other donor agencies procedures;
  • Has experience with private security companies and contractors;
  • Has experience conducting training for small groups;
  • Has comprehensive knowledge of regional and national security issues;
  • Has demonstrated an understanding of complex emergencies, related security concerns and appropriate responses to such emergencies;
  • Has communication skills for explaining complex security concerns, policies, protocols, and procedures to senior management, employees and consultants

Skills:

  • Written and spoken fluency in English required;
  • Good at using Microsoft suites (Words, Excel, PowerPoint, etc);
  • Able to plan, execute and continuously improve her/his work independently and/or in close collaboration with colleagues
